Launch exhibition ‘Drawn to sport’
June 12, 2014 @ 6:00 pm - 8:00 pm
The exhibition is a celebration of the life and artwork of Huddersfield born Ken Taylor. A local cricket and football legend, he played cricket for Yorkshire and England and football for Huddersfield Town. He developed a talent for art at an early age and went to the prestigious Slade Art School in London, he eventually went on to become an art teacher in Norfolk.
The exhibition will contain paintings of Huddersfield when the mills were still there. There will also be drawings of national football and cricket colleagues, some of them signed.
There will also be sporting memorabilia.
